77% Of Users Don't Rely On Reviews That Are Older Than Three Months
Customers don't care how excellent your product or service was in the past. Part of why online reviews matter is due to the fact that they are fresh and relevant.
Consumers understand businesses lose their touch all the time, which is why most of them find older reviews irrelevant.
It is for this reason that businesses ought to be constantly asking for reviews.

49% Of Consumers Consider The Number Of Online Reviews As An Important Factor In Their Purchasing Decision
Customers value not only the quality or nature of the reviews, however they consider their quantity and recency as well.
The share of consumers, who take note of the number of reviews is presently at 46 percent.

A Single Business Review Can Lift Its Conversions By 10%
Online review stats show user-generated material can do miracles in regards to conversions.
A single review can have an enormous effect on your business.
A hundred reviews can boost your conversion rates by as much as 37 percent. Two hundred can offer an astonishing 44 percent boost.

73% Of Consumers Think Client Reviews Are More Crucial Than Star And Number Ratings
Online review stats make it clear individuals aren't satisfied with scores alone.
Written reviews make the statistics appear more authentic which is what the potential consumers are looking for. Nearly a 3rd of customers say written reviews are the only feature that makes them believe the sites' reviews are useful and pertinent.

Majority Of Customers Won't Use A Service If It Has Less Than A 4 Star Score
This stat is among lots of that show the value of online rankings. Now that news of customer complete satisfaction travels this fast, keeping your clients pleased is more important than ever.
57% of consumers have actually searched for companies with more than four stars in 2018, which is up from 48% in 2017.
11 percent looked just for services with a perfect five star ranking.

83% Of All Younger People Were Invited To Post A Review Recently
Of those invited, 80% of customers did post a review. Overall, businesses have actually asked 66% of all consumers to leave a review on their business.
